DTC P1895/DTC NO.27 TORQUE REDUCTION SIGNAL CIRCUIT
WIRING DIAGRAM
TROUBLESHOOTING
STEP
1
Was "A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ION DIAG-
NOSTIC FLOW TABLE" performed?
2
Check Torque Reduction Signal Circuit.
1) Check voltage between terminal E25-18
and body ground with ignition switch ON.
Is it 4 – 6 V?
3
Check Power Supply from ECM.
1) Disconnect TCM coupler with ignition
switch OFF.
2) Check voltage between terminal E25-18 of
disconnected TCM connector and body
ground with ignition switch ON.
Is it 4 – 6 V?
